n.
One who sells goods aggressively, especially by calling out.
[Middle English hauker, probably from Middle Low German höker, from hōken, to peddle, bend, bear on the back.]

The noun has 2 meanings:
Meaning #1:
someone who travels about selling his wares (as on the streets or at carnivals)
Synonyms: peddler, pedlar, packman, pitchman
Meaning #2:
a person who breeds and trains hawks and who follows the sport of falconry
Synonym: falconer
